人力検索はてな
モバイル版を表示しています。PC版はこちら
i-mobile

VBAで標準で扱っている文字コードは何ですか?

●質問者: Ficus_palmeri
●カテゴリ:コンピュータ
✍キーワード:VBA 文字コード
○ 状態 :終了
└ 回答数 : 2/2件

▽最新の回答へ

1 ● borin
●25ポイント

http://www.google.co.jp/search?num=30&hl=ja&q=VBA%E3%81%...

Google

VBAは文字列をユニコードで扱っているようです。

◎質問者からの返答

UTF-8とかですか?


2 ● nitscape
●25ポイント

http://ja.wikipedia.org/wiki/Unicode

Unicode - Wikipedia

VBAで使われているのは「UTF-16」というユニコードです。1文字が2バイトでリトルエンディアンで表現される(WindowsNT系では)一般的に使われているものです。


UTF-8は文字によって1文字が1バイトのこともあれば複数になることもあります。UTF-8とUTF-16は相互に変換可能です。


http://www.microsoft.com/japan/msdn/library/default.asp?url=/jap...

MSDN ライブラリ サイト移行に関する重要なお知らせ

テキストファイルなどで昔から用いられているシフトJISなどの文字列をVBAに読み込むときはユニコードに変換する必要があります。そのようなときはstrconvという命令を利用します。

◎質問者からの返答

なるほど.よくわかりました.

ありがとうございます.

関連質問


●質問をもっと探す●



0.人力検索はてなトップ
8.このページを友達に紹介
9.このページの先頭へ
対応機種一覧
お問い合わせ
ヘルプ/お知らせ
ログイン
無料ユーザー登録
はてなトップ